Some surface mining methods include open-pit mining, strip mining, mountaintop removal mining, and placer mining. These methods involve removing the overlying material to access the desired mineral deposits near the surface. Surface mining is often used for coal, metals, and other minerals that are located close to the Earth's surface.

Some pros of open pit mining include lower costs compared to underground mining, higher productivity due to easier access to the deposits, and the ability to extract a large quantity of minerals. Additionally, open pit mining can be more environmentally friendly in terms of land reclamation and restoration post-mining.
Gold mining typically involves both surface mining and underground mining. Initially, surface mining techniques such as panning, sluicing, and dredging are used to extract gold from shallow deposits. As the easier-to-access gold becomes depleted, underground mining methods like shaft mining and drift mining are employed to access deeper ore deposits.
Some common tools used in surface mining include excavators, bulldozers, haul trucks, draglines, wheel loaders, and blasthole drills. These tools are used to extract minerals and other materials from the earth's surface efficiently and safely.
Cyanide is commonly used in mining to extract gold and other precious metals from ores. It forms a strong bond with gold, allowing it to dissolve and separate from the ore. However, the use of cyanide in mining can pose environmental and health risks if not managed properly.
